India captain Virat Kohli on Tuesday lost his cool at Shardul Thakur after the medium-pacer was slow to react on the field, allowing England to take an extra run during the third T20 International. Defending a modest total of 156 against a strong England batting line-up in Ahmedabad, Kohli knew India had to keep it very tight with their bowling and fielding to try and put some pressure on England and keep themselves in the game. In the 12th over, Jonny Bairstow nudged the ball to the leg side and Shardul Thakur was slow to react, and when he did get to the ball, he sent back a wild throw that went towards cover rather than at either of the stumps.

Virat Kohli's brilliance wasn't good enough to paper over an otherwise inept Indian batting performance as England humbled the hosts by eight wickets in the third T20 International to take a 2-1 lead in the five-match series in Ahmedabad on Tuesday. Eoin Morgan unleashed his fast bowlers Mark Wood (3/31) and Chris Jordan (2/35) to restrict the hosts for 156 for 6, which the visitors surpassed easily in 18.2 overs, riding on Jos Buttler's unbeaten 83 off 52 balls. Skipper Kohli had mistakenly said at the toss that his team led 2-1 but Morgan, in his 100th T20 International appearance, made sure that opposite happened.

India captain Virat Kohli called debutant Ishan Kishan "a fearless character" after the latter's whirlwind 56 off just 32 balls helped India beat England by seven wickets in the second T20I against England in Ahmedabad on Sunday. Kohli, who himself smashed 73 off just 49 balls and became the first player in men's cricket to reach 3000 T20I runs, praised Kishan for his calculated strokes. "Special mention to Ishan the way he batted. I tried to do what I can but he kept following his instincts and it was a quality innings on debut," Kohli said after the match.

Ishan Kishan made his international debut on Sunday, making an instant impact with a fiery half-century in the second Twenty20 International (T20I) against England at the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ad. Kishan, who has made a name for himself in recent times with some fine performances for Mumbai Indians in the Indian Premier League, hit the ground running on the international stage, smashing a 32-ball 56. He had the perfect mentor at the other end in Virat Kohli, who remained unbeaten on 73 as India easily overhauled England's 164/6. Speaking about the Indian captain, Kishan said that he had never experienced the sort of energy that Kohli exudes while batting.

As Ishan Kishan and Suryakumar Yadav made their international debuts for India in the second T20I against England in Ahmedabad, Michael Vaughan tweeted jokingly that India had taken his suggestion of playing Mumbai Indians players in the XI. Vaughan had tweeted during the first T20I that the IPL team is better than India in T20s. "I see @BCCI have taken the advice & got more @mipaltan players involved ... Very smart move ..." tweeted Vaughan before the second T20I began on Sunday.

Virat Kohli slammed the winning six to seal a win for India against England in the second T20I of the five-match series, at the Narendra Modi Stadium. In reply to England's target of 165 runs, captain Kohli scored an unbeaten knock of 73 in 49 balls, to help India reach 166 for three in 17.5 overs. The hosts had a poor start to their chase, losing KL Rahul for a duck. But after the arrival of Kohli, India began to gain momentum and also saw the skipper stitch together a partnership with debutant Ishan Kishan. Kishan also registered a half-century (56 off 32 balls), before getting dismissed. Rishabh Pant also made a noteworthy contribution of 26 runs, with Shreyas Iyer (8) remaining unbeaten with Kohli. The visiting bowlers couldn't really find their footing in the second T20I, with Sam Curran, Chris Jordan and Adil Rashid registering a wicket each. Earlier, the visitors could only muster 164 for six in 20 overs, with Jason Roy (46 off 35) once again missing out on a half-century. For India's bowling department, Washington Sundar and Shardul Thakur were in top form, registering two wickets each. Meanwhile, Bhuvneshwar Kumar and Yuzvendra Chahal took a dismissal each. The win has also helped India level the series at 1-1, with the third T20I scheduled for March 16. (SCORECARD)

The day and the match, however, belonged to England as the visitors easily chased down the paltry target of 125 in just 15.3 overs to take a 1-0 series lead. 
England had won the toss, and elected to field.
Jofra Archer struck in the second over of the match as Rahul dragged a widish delivery back onto his stumps. India captain Virat Kohli fell in the next over to Adil Rashid, lobbing an easy catch to Chris Jordan at mid-off.
Things went from bad to worse as Shikhar Dhawan got out to a rash shot off Mark Wood to leave India tottering at 20 for three in five overs. Shreyas Iyer scored a fine half-century but India never really got on top of the England bowling and were retricted to 124 for seven in their 20 overs.
